Demand for gasoline was falling as Americans prepared for the Thanksgiving holiday – typically a time when many venture away from home to visit family and friends.

That’s according to Energy Information Administration data showing that less people are filling up their tanks and more supply is coming online, pushing prices downward slightly. The national average price for regular gasoline is down to $3.72 per gallon this week compared with last, according to AAA.

Though prices are coming down from record-setting summer highs, they’ll remain elevated over last year’s prices meaning that Americans can expect the most expensive travel season in 10 years, according to a recent report from Gasbuddy.

Stacker compiled statistics on gas prices in Connecticut. Gas prices are as of November 23. The state gas tax data is from World Population Review. Connecticut and New York have temporarily suspended gas taxes to help consumers while the cost of gas has increased.

Connecticut by the numbers
– Gas current price: $3.68
– Week change: -$0.08 (-2.2%)
– Year change: +$0.12 (+3.4%)
– Gas tax: $0.25 per gallon (#29 highest among all states)
– Historical expensive gas price: $4.98 (6/14/22)

– Diesel current price: $6.03
– Week change: -$0.10 (-1.7%)
– Year change: +$2.33 (+62.8%)
– Historical expensive diesel price: $6.44 (5/18/22)

Metros with the most expensive gas in Connecticut
#1. Bridgeport: $3.76
#2. Lower Fairfield County: $3.74
#3. Windham: $3.71
#4. New Haven-Meriden: $3.69
#5. Hartford: $3.64
#6. New London-Norwich (CT only): $3.63
